Output 48153ba5a26da906dd8f3f573df6b0c5a30b31c91aa01ac2ea83d759ba2d9b2b:2

value
24047992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aa7bc040b9efdf06b645de056f58a9f2512bbb OP_EQUAL
address
MEhxU27rHq6EL1yneAJbJfr6orirjoPEZQ
transaction
48153ba5a26da906dd8f3f573df6b0c5a30b31c91aa01ac2ea83d759ba2d9b2b
spent
true